Inspiring Arab women.
‘Seera’ is Arabic for ‘biography’ or 'her story' and will cover real and raw topics discussed with incredible women from the Middle East.
These women are challenging stereotypes, disrupting the status quo and breaking the glass ceiling.
We ask, what is her story?
